在PostgreSQL中,使用to_date函数可以将字符串转换为日期类型。但是需要注意的是,使用to_date函数仅能更改数据的格式,而不会更改数据的位数。 具体来说,to_date函数接受两个参数:第一个参数是要转换的字符串,第二个参数是指定的日期格式。它将字符串按照指定的格式解析,并返回一个日期类型的值。
PostgreSQL是一种开源的关系型数据库管理系统,它支持丰富的数据类型和功能。在PostgreSQL语言中,to_date函数用于将字符串转换为日期类型。正则表达式是一种强大的模式匹配工具,它可以用于在字符串中查找和匹配特定的模式。 to_date函数结合正则表达式可以用于解析包含日期信息的字符串,并将其转换为日期类型。它的语法如下:...
解决方案:在调用to_date()函数之前,先对输入字符串进行日期有效性检查。可以使用EXTRACT()函数提取日期的各个部分,并手动检查其有效性。 SELECTCASEWHENEXTRACT(DAYFROMto_date('2023-02-30','YYYY-MM-DD'))>28THEN'Invalid date'ELSE'Valid date'END; AI代码助手复制代码 3. 总结 to_date()函数是PostgreSQL...
红色框是PostgreSQL内置的to_date函数,并返回 date类型。 在PostgreSQL中, date类型与 Oracle的Date类型不一致,它不带时分秒。因此,当我们从 Oracle迁移到 PostgreSQL为了兼容,将使用 timetamp类型进行转换,因此表上的 crtime是 timestamp类型。 问题的解决也很简单,使用第三方插件提供的to_date函数,返回 timestamp类型...
51CTO博客已为您找到关于数据库 postgresql to_date的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及数据库 postgresql to_date问答内容。更多数据库 postgresql to_date相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
PostgreSQL将日期转为当前年月日的函数 plsql日期转换成数字,1.转换函数:1.1TO_DATE:功能:将字符串变量根据模式格式串转换为日期变量格式:TO_DATE(string[,format]):年份:用Y表示:如四位年份表示为YYYY,三位为YYY,两位为YYYYYY四位的年份YYY三位年份YY两位年份
TO_DATE(#{startTime}, 'YYYY-MM-DD') AND op_date <![CDATA[>= ]]> TO_TIMESTAMP(#{beginTime}, 'YYYY-MM-DD HH24:MI:SS') AND op_date <![CDATA[<= ]]> TO_TIMESTAMP(#{endTime}, 'YYYY-MM-DD HH24:MI:SS') 而页面要接收和传递数据需要在javaBean中写如下 @JsonFormat(pattern="...
postgresql数据库 to_date()函数,to_timestamp()函数 所以,我们在比较带有时分秒的日期的时候,一定要使用to_timestamp()函数是最准确的。
SELECTCAST('15'ASINTEGER),'2020-03-15'::DATE;int4|date|---|---|15|2020-03-15| 如果数据无法转换为指定的类型,将会返回错误: SELECTCAST('A15'ASINTEGER);SQL错误[22P02]:错误:无效的类型integer输入语法:"A15"位置:14 to_date 函数 to_date(string...
1、首先需要找到一个带日期字段的数据表。2、接下来向表中插入日期值。3、然后通过month函数获取月份即可,注意month里添加的是列名。4、运行SQL语句以后发现日期中的月份已经被提取出来了。5、另外还可以在Month中直接加GETDATE函数获取当前时间的月份。方案...